Can I eat dumplings while pregnant?
Yes, you can eat dumplings during pregnancy. However, it is best to choose steamed over fried dumplings and consume them in moderation, keeping in mind the sodium and fat content.
How can I make yum cha healthier during pregnancy?
For a healthier option, select steamed dishes, request less salt, and avoid adding soy sauce. Pair your yum cha with fresh vegetables to balance nutrients and manage calorie intake effectively.
